Previous India batter Manoj Tiwary has actually stated that Mumbai’s captaincy might be restored to Rohit Sharma. The five-time Indian Premier League champs have actually caught 3 back-to-back losses to start their 2024 season under the management of all-rounder Hardik Pandya following his historical trade relocation from Gujarat. Pandya was traded from Gujarat after an effective stint as their skipper, leading them to the IPL title in 2022 and taking them all the method to the last in 2023. He changed veteran captain Rohit at the helm in Mumbai however is yet to register his very first win as their captain.
Speaking with Cricbuzz after Mumbai’ s loss versus Rajasthan, Tiwary stated Rohit might be made Mumbai’ s captain as soon as again following a bad start in the 2024 season. Rajasthan limited Mumbai to 125 for 9 in the very first innings before going after the under-par target down with 6 wickets and 27 balls staying. Under Pandya’ s management, Mumbai has actually suffered beats versus Gujarat and Hyderabad, losing by 6 runs and 31 runs respectively.

Mumbai’s captaincy might be restored to Rohit Sharma. What I comprehend is that the owners of Mumbai Indians do not be reluctant in making choices. They made the call of taking the captaincy from Rohit and providing it to Hardik Pandya regardless of Rohit winning 5 IPL titles for them,” stated Tiwary.
Changing the captain is a huge call. They have actually not gotten a single point this season. And the captaincy is likewise all over the location, it’s not simply misfortune and the captaincy has actually been excellent, that’s not the case. The captaincy has actually not been excellent,” Tiwary included.
Pandya has actually withstood a difficult start to his captaincy stint with MI, losing the very first 3 matches of IPL 2024 while being continuously booed by crowds anywhere he goes. Pandya dealt with the crowd’ s rage in Ahmedabad, Hyderabad and remarkably, at Mumbai’ s home ground at the Wankhede.
Previous skipper Rohit needed to prompt the home crowd to stop booing Pandya throughout MI’ s beat versus Rajasthan. The Mumbai-based franchise will be seeking to get better to winning methods when they handle Delhi Capitals on Sunday, April 7.
